First off, I would never let my tank get down to E. The fuel pump starts to suck up any sediment on the bottom and then your fuel filter will clog up and you have bigger problems. I don't like to let it go too far below half and try to never let it go past a quarter tank. That's what happened with my other van that was using double gas and we finally sold. I let it get low and after I filled up it never acted right again. May have been a coincidence but maybe not. The chart is cool, but doesn't list our van(s). But my wife’s car is on there and she can go 60+ miles on E. Yeah, never let it get that low!
